how did the french and indian war impact the english government and the colonists

Answers

Answer:

The French and Indian War began in 1754 and ended with the Treaty of Paris in 1763. The war provided Great Britain enormous territorial gains in North America, but disputes over subsequent frontier policy and paying the war's expenses led to colonial discontent, and ultimately to the American Revolution.

Why is the Magdalena River so important?

The basin provides 70% of the country's hydroelectric electricity and 90% of its thermoelectric power. Additionally, it provides drinking water to 38 million people. In addition to its ecological and economic significance, the Magdalena serves as Colombia's cultural hub and is engrained in both its history and culture.

The Magdalena River is Colombia's principal river. Between the Andean Cordilleras Central and Oriental in the south and the Caribbean Sea in the north, it traverses up the western portion of Colombia for roughly 1000 kilometers.

The Magdalena River, Colombia's largest river, spans the country in a south-to-north direction for 1,500 kilometers before draining into the Caribbean Sea. It can be seen in the southern Huila and has a width of only a few kilometers.

1) What is the difference between the Roman
Republic and the Roman Empire?

Answers

Answer:

The main difference between the Roman Republic and the Roman Empire was that the former was a democratic society and the latter was run by only one man. Also, the Roman Republic was in an almost constant state of war, whereas the Roman Empire's first 200 years were relatively peaceful.
